needs paint by karl kindt from the GigaPan THE HOUSE ACCROSS THE STREET by MIKE COOPER
by using the zoom feature of a gigapan image an inspector can create this kind of image then go back to his shop zoom in on the property and find flaws that would require a ladder to discover. If further inspection is necessary he has a more focused second visit to the property saving time and helping him in being comprehensive for his client.
